The Challenge: The Hidden Operational Cost of Poor UX

A leading Indian investment platform with 18 lakh active accounts faced a massive operational challenge: their customer support team was overwhelmed by a volume of over 14,000 support tickets every month. The support queue was congested, causing average ticket resolution times to rise to 36 hours. An in-depth analysis of the ticket categories revealed that 60% of the customer support burden was caused by repetitive, preventable issues. These issues were concentrated around three main stages: failed bank account linking, manual IFSC entry typos, and locked accounts due to repeated Aadhaar OTP resend attempts.

Instead of addressing these issues by hiring more support executives, we proposed treating the user interface as the primary support tool. By mapping support ticket logs directly to specific screens, we could identify the design flaws causing user confusion and fix them upfront in the interface, thereby reducing the support burden and saving on operational costs.

The Support-to-UX Mapping and Redesign

We established a continuous feedback loop between the Zendesk support tagging system and the product design system. We implemented three targeted user experience modifications based on support data:

  1. Penny-Drop Visual Progress Tracker: Previously, when a user linked their bank account, the screen displayed a static loader for up to 60 seconds while a ₹1 penny-drop transaction was executed to verify the account. Users, thinking the app was frozen, would close it and submit a ticket. We replaced this loader with a step-by-step progress timeline showing each stage (e.g., "Connecting to bank...", "Sending ₹1 test deposit...", "Confirming account name...").
  2. Smart IFSC Verification Tool: Over 1,800 monthly support queries were linked to manual IFSC entry errors, such as typing the letter "O" instead of the number "0" (e.g., entering "SBIO..." instead of "SBIN0..."). We replaced the manual input field with an auto-populating IFSC directory, allowing users to select their bank, state, and branch name from a clean drop-down menu, eliminating entry errors.
  3. Structural OTP Countdown Timers: To resolve issues with users clicking "Resend OTP" multiple times during SMS delivery delays (which locked their accounts for 24 hours due to security rules), we added a high-visibility, 60-second countdown timer. The "Resend OTP" button was completely disabled during this period, with a clear status note explaining that cellular networks might experience temporary delays.

Key Insights on Support-Reducing Design

By studying ticket logs before and after our interface modifications, we identified three core design principles for reducing support burdens:

First, input validation must happen in the client browser. Preventing a user from submitting a form with incorrect characters (e.g. flagging a 9-digit PAN or a 10-digit IFSC immediately in red with an explanation) prevents database write errors and stops support tickets before they are generated. Second, use in-context helper cards. Placing a brief instruction directly below input fields (such as "Enter your bank account holder name exactly as it appears on your PAN card") prevents name mismatches during bank verification. Third, inform users about third-party API delays. If UIDAI or KRA servers are down, display a prominent warning banner (e.g., "Aadhaar servers are currently running slow; verification may take up to 2 minutes") rather than leaving users in the dark.

The Results: 4-Week Post-Launch Performance

The updated onboarding and verification layouts were launched to all users. A 4-week post-launch audit demonstrated massive operational improvements:

  • Support Ticket Volume: Total monthly support tickets dropped by 34%, falling from 14,200 to 9,372, saving significant operational costs.
  • IFSC-related Queries: Support tickets regarding "invalid IFSC" were completely eliminated.
  • Penny-Drop Success Rate: Bank account verification success rose from 88% to 96.4%.
  • Account Lockouts: OTP resend lockouts decreased by 72% within the first month.
